The Manly Mitts
by Mary Fellman
At last, the “manly” set is complete with these Manly Mitts, which match the Manly Hat, Manly Scarf, and Manly Möbius. These are a no-nonsense accessory for a guy who needs his fingers free, knitting up quickly in worsted-weight yarn. The central cable is easy and intuitive (and not too fussy), with complementary “barbed wire” stitch borders.
Requires approximately 150 yards (or 65g) of any worsted-weight wool with roughly 200 yards to 100g. I used Cascade 220 in color 8012.
(The entire set requires at least 300g of yarn.)
